Definitions
[ʃɪn], (Noun)
Definitions:
- the front of the leg below the knee
Phrases:
Origin
:
Old English scinu, probably from a Germanic base meaning ‘narrow or thin piece’; related to German Schiene ‘thin plate’ and Dutch scheen. The verb was originally in nautical use (early 19th century)
[ʃɪn], (Verb)
Definitions:
- climb quickly up or down by gripping with one's arms and legs
(e.g: he shinned up a tree)
